Ошибка при создании проекта в Xcode
Я получаю следующую ошибку при создании проекта.
Клинство тоже не помогло. Не знаю, что пошло не так внезапно.
CompileAssetCatalog /Users/Mayu/Library/Developer/Xcode/DerivedData/Pizza_to_Go-dohdzfdfbyycqrhirbysuinqfuzf/Build/Products/Debug-iphonesimulator/Pizza\ to\ Go.app Pizza\ to\ Go/Images.xcassets Pizza\ to\ Go/Images.xcassets
cd "/Users/Mayu/Documents/development/git/pizzatogo/iPhoneApp/Pizza to Go"
setenv PATH "/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/usr/bin:/Applications/Xcode.app/Contents/Developer/usr/bin:/usr/bin:/bin:/usr/sbin:/sbin"
/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/usr/bin/actool --output-format human-readable-text --notices --warnings --export-dependency-info /Users/Mayu/Library/Developer/Xcode/DerivedData/Pizza_to_Go-dohdzfdfbyycqrhirbysuinqfuzf/Build/Intermediates/Pizza\ to\ Go.build/Debug-iphonesimulator/Pizza\ to\ Go.build/assetcatalog_dependencies.txt --output-partial-info-plist /Users/Mayu/Library/Developer/Xcode/DerivedData/Pizza_to_Go-dohdzfdfbyycqrhirbysuinqfuzf/Build/Intermediates/Pizza\ to\ Go.build/Debug-iphonesimulator/Pizza\ to\ Go.build/assetcatalog_generated_info.plist --app-icon AppIcon --launch-image LaunchImage --platform iphonesimulator --minimum-deployment-target 7.0 --target-device iphone --compress-pngs --compile /Users/Mayu/Library/Developer/Xcode/DerivedData/Pizza_to_Go-dohdzfdfbyycqrhirbysuinqfuzf/Build/Products/Debug-iphonesimulator/Pizza\ to\ Go.app /Users/Mayu/Documents/development/git/pizzatogo/iPhoneApp/Pizza\ to\ Go/Pizza\ to\ Go/Images.xcassets /Users/Mayu/Documents/development/git/pizzatogo/iPhoneApp/Pizza\ to\ Go/Pizza\ to\ Go/Images.xcassets
/* com.apple.actool.errors */
: error: There are multiple app icon set instances named "AppIcon".
: error: There are multiple launch image set instances named "LaunchImage".
/* com.apple.actool.compilation-results */
/Users/Mayu/Library/Developer/Xcode/DerivedData/Pizza_to_Go-dohdzfdfbyycqrhirbysuinqfuzf/Build/Products/Debug-iphonesimulator/Pizza to Go.app/Assets.car
/Users/Mayu/Library/Developer/Xcode/DerivedData/Pizza_to_Go-dohdzfdfbyycqrhirbysuinqfuzf/Build/Intermediates/Pizza to Go.build/Debug-iphonesimulator/Pizza to Go.build/assetcatalog_generated_info.plist
Ответы
Ответ 1
Как говорится в этой ошибке, у вас есть дублированные изображения AppIcon и LaunchImage. Чтобы отсортировать его, просто сделайте копию и удалите его из своего проекта (посмотрите на Images.xcassets и удалите его также). После этого снова импортируйте его в Images.xcassets.
Ответ 2
Ошибка: несколько экземпляров AppIcon (при работе со Storyboard).
Это решение работало для меня:
Посмотрите в окне раскадровки. Панель навигации для дублирования списка изображений Images.xcassets. Если есть, выделите его и нажмите клавишу удаления. Когда его спросят, выберите "удалить ссылку" - не отправлять в корзину (что может удалить фактическую папку Images.xcassets). По-видимому, этот дублированный листинг в проекте может произойти, если попытка прервана, чтобы импортировать что-то в Images.xcassetes.
Ответ 3
Для меня проблема заключалась в том, что у меня была папка с активами с несколькими целями, а у расширений уже были назначены эти цели. Исправлено было убедиться, что каждая папка актива была назначена только для конкретной цели или удалить папки, которые не нужны.
![введите описание изображения здесь]()